Solder Alloy 301 vs. Solder Alloy 811

Both solder alloy 301 and solder alloy 811 are otherwise unclassified metals. Both are furnished in the as-fabricated (no temper or treatment) condition. They have 45% of their average alloy composition in common. There are 22 material properties with values for both materials.
